TURN-208: Gatevale turnstile counters at the Merrow Field pilot double-count when a rotation reverses mid-cycle. Attendance totals drift roughly 2% high per event. The debounce window fix is implemented, reviewed by Ilsa, and soak-tested across two simulated match days without drift. Ready for your cut; the candidate build is identified below.

trace token, tagag-tafog: htk6_5ed18c

## Support

Liftraft is the elevator-dispatch simulator used by the Vantmore platform team. Bug reports should include the scenario file, the seed value, and the tick at which dispatch behavior diverged from expectations. Feature requests go through the quarterly planning board; do not open them as bugs. Documentation lives alongside the code in the docs directory and is the source of truth. For questions that the docs and scenario library do not answer, email the maintainers at the address below.

escalation mailbox, bafog-fafog: ulador@paliqlabs.internal

Subject: Key rotation — consent banner rollout

Hi! Quick heads-up before you dig into the Lumenfold consent banner work: we rotated the credentials for the Pellwick preferences service last night, so the one in your setup notes is dead. Swap it out before running the rollout script. The new key is right below.

service key, kahag-fajep: zpat2_d6

To: Executive Team
Subject: Logistics provider change

Confirming we move from Tarnwick Haulage to Silverline Dispatch on the first of next month. Delivery windows tighten from 72 to 48 hours. Sales leads: update customer commitments accordingly. No pricing changes this quarter. Full contract terms are with legal. Background on the decision follows in the confidential note below.

management briefing: The pricing group signed off on a budget of $378.8 million for Project Kasael.

Handover: Copperdale pool tuning

For review: I migrated the Wrenfall API to the shared connection pooler. Pool sizing was chosen from peak-hour measurements, not defaults, and idle reaping is deliberately aggressive to avoid exhausting the primary. Please check the timeout interplay carefully. The pooler starts with the configuration values listed below.

settings of yahag-yafog:
[pramir]
host = pramir.qirvancorp.internal
user = pramir_svc
database = pramir_prod